/* CSS Document */

#product_focus {
	clear: both;
}

#product_focus h1 { 
	color: #333333;
	font-size: 300%;
	text-align: left;
}


table#gallery_thumbs {
	width: 200px;
	border-collapse: separate;
	border-spacing: 2px 2px 2px 2px;
	margin: 10px 15px 0 0;
	float: right;
}

div#content>table#gallery_thumbs {
	width: 100%;
	border-collapse: separate;
	border-spacing: 3px;
	padding: 0;
	margin: 0 0 2px 0;
}

table#gallery_thumbs td {
	padding-top: 2px; /* IE was lopping off the top borders of all anchors in these cells without the extra top padding... */
}

/* IE 6 doesn't recognize the descendent selector so these are hidden */
table#gallery_thumbs tr>td {
	padding-top: 0px;
}

table#gallery_thumbs a {
	border: solid 2px #D1F0EB; 
}

table#gallery_thumbs a:hover {
	border: solid 2px #F4A7DF; /* IE 6 only recognizes :hover selectors for anchor tags */
}

/* IE 6 doesn't recognize the descendent selector so these are hidden */
table#gallery_thumbs tr>td>a {
	border: none;
}

/* IE 6 doesn't recognize the descendent selector so these are hidden */
table#gallery_thumbs tr>td>a:hover {
	border: none;
}

/* IE 6 doesn't recognize the descendent selector so these are hidden */
table#gallery_thumbs tr>td>a {
	border: solid 2px #D1F0EB;
}


table#gallery_thumbs tr>td>a:hover {
	border: solid 2px #F4A7DF;
}



#item_1 a, #item_2 a, #item_3 a, #item_4 a, #item_5 a, #item_6 a, #item_7 a, #item_8 a, #item_9 a, #item_10 a, #item_11 a, #item_12 a, #item_13 a, #item_14 a   {
	height: 90px;
	width: 100px;
}

#item_1 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/martin_bishop_button.jpg) no-repeat left -90px;
	float: right;
}

#item_1 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_2 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/starchaser_button.jpg) no-repeat left -90px;
	float: right;
}

#item_2 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_3 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/jacky_button.jpg) no-repeat left -90px;
	float: right;
}

#item_3 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_4 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/inshinzi_button.jpg) no-repeat left -90px;
	float: right;
}

#item_4 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_5 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/zixxoit_button.jpg) no-repeat left -90px;
	float: right;
}

#item_5 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_6 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/vedlatsu_button.jpg) no-repeat left -90px;
	float: right;
}

#item_6 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_7 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/roswell_omen_2_button.jpg) no-repeat left -90px;
	float: right;
}

#item_7 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_8 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/chase_button.jpg) no-repeat left -90px;
	float: right;
}

#item_8 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_9 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
	background:url(images/buttons/slave_leia_button.jpg) no-repeat left -90px;
	float: right;
}

#item_9 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_10 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
background:url(images/buttons/hoth_luke_poster_button.jpg) no-repeat left -90px;
	float: right;
}

#item_10 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_11 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
background:url(images/buttons/hoth_luke_2_button.jpg) no-repeat left -90px;
	float: right;
}

#item_11 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_12 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
background:url(images/buttons/endor_luke_button.jpg) no-repeat left -90px;
	float: right;
}

#item_12 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_13 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
background:url(images/buttons/endor_luke_2_button.jpg) no-repeat left -90px;
	float: right;
}

#item_13 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}

#item_14 a {
	border: solid 2px #D1F0EB;
	margin: 0 0 0 0;
	padding: 0 0 0 0;
	display: block;
background:url(images/buttons/lando_sarlacc_button.jpg) no-repeat left -90px;
	float: right;
}

#item_14 a:hover {
	background-position: 0% 0px;
	text-decoration: none;
	border: solid 2px #F4A7DF;
}